You should definitely think twice before you hire out a company dealing specifically in social media marketing. A number of these companies are scams that prey on business owners who have no experience with Internet marketing. These companies use proxy servers and registration bots to create thousands of accounts on Twitter, YouTube and Facebook. This means that your advertisements are not likely to be seen by any actual people, even though the amount of views will continue to rise and you have spent your money.

You should put your email and social media marketing together. At the end of your emails, include a Twitter or Facebook link and advise recipients that their questions will receive personal answers when posed on these websites. You might also could encourage folks to sign up for your newsletter by including the registration page link.
You can share updates from Twitter users that you find influential, or you can just mention them by typing their usernames following the @ symbol in your posts. By doing this, they receive notification that you have posted about them. This can either lead to a tweet reply, or they will re-broadcast your post to a wider audience.
